Scrapbook, 1920-1922
Scope and Contents
The Mary Elizabeth Ewing Scrapbook is dark brown, measuring 16.6" x 12" and bearing the title "The University of North Dakota Memory Book" on its cover-page. An ownership tag on the second page identifies it as the property of Mary Elizabeth Ewing, and states she was a member of the Class of 1923 and a resident of Larimore Hall. The next eight pages contain information about Mary's friends, including their names, dates of their signatures, hometowns, birthdates, nicknames, class years, etc. (space was provided for photographs, but only two friends are actually pictured). Following are several pages for recording information about varsity sports, all of them left blank except for the sections for football and basketball. Additional entries were made under the headings "Societies", "Stunts, Spreads, Parties, etc.", "College, Class, and Social Functions", "My Favorites", and "The Faculty." On a page marked "Dormitories at U.N.D.", Mary mounted pictures of Corwin-Larimore and Sayre Halls, as well as Macnie and Budge Halls. The next two pages contain photographs of the Main Building (formerly located between Merrifield and Twamley; now the site of the Eternal Flame), Science Hall (demolished), University Commons (now Montgomery Hall), and the old Library Building (now used for administration). The remainder of the book contains various photographs, notes, programs, and other items of memorabilia. It appears that many more items were part of the scrapbook at one point, but have since been lost.
